7. The points (3,5) and (2, y) are on a line with a slope of 3. Find y.​
PtichkaEL [24]

Answer:

We get value of y: y = 2

Step-by-step explanation:

The points (3,5) and (2, y) are on a line with a slope of 3. Find y.​

We can find y using formula of finding slope of a line.

The formula is: Slope=\frac{y_2-y_1}{x_2-x_1}

We have x_1=3, y_1=5, x_2=2, y_2=y and Slope = 3

Putting values and finding y

Slope=\frac{y_2-y_1}{x_2-x_1}\\3=\frac{y-5}{2-3}\\3=\frac{y-5}{-1}\\-1(3)=y-5\\-3=y-5\\y=-3+5\\y=2

So, we get value of y: y = 2
